Netsmart Technologies (ntst.com) is a healthcare software and IT solution provider headquartered in Overland Park, Kansas. Founded in 1968, the company specializes in developing integrated electronic health record (EHR) systems, revenue cycle management (RCM) platforms, data analytics, and care coordination tools tailored for community-based healthcare providers. Its software suites primarily serve human services, behavioral health, addiction treatment, autism care, and post-acute healthcare sectors (including home care, hospice, and senior living communities).
